The longevity of a power station depends on several factors:
Battery type: LiFePO4 batteries offer over 3000–5000 charge cycles, while Li-ion typically delivers 500–1000 cycles.
Build quality: Durable materials, solid internal components, and weather-resistant casing extend physical lifespan.
Thermal management: Prevents battery overheating and degradation over time.
Battery management systems (BMS): Regulate charging/discharging and protect battery integrity.
A “cycle” means one full charge and discharge. So, a 3000-cycle LiFePO4 station used once daily can last over 8 years.

Avoid full discharge (keep battery above 10%)
Store at 40–60% charge when not in use
Keep away from extreme heat or freezing conditions
Use a compatible solar panel or charger
Periodically check and run the system—even in storage
